The College of Nursing Club in Abha Organizes the Program “The Saving Hands” to Enhance First Aid Skills

Source
Institutional Communication Center - Deanship of Student Affairs

The College of Nursing Club in Abha, in collaboration with the Student Affairs Agency for Female Students and with the participation of the Maternal and Child Nursing Department, organized the program “The Saving Hands” on Monday, October 6, 2025, as part of awareness activities aimed at promoting first aid knowledge among students and familiarizing them with essential emergency procedures before the arrival of medical staff. The program included an introductory presentation on the concept of first aid and the importance of swift action to save lives, along with practical exercises on scenarios such as cardiopulmonary resuscitation, bleeding control, and dealing with burns and choking incidents.

The College of Law Club Organizes a Mock Trial on Human Trafficking as Practical Training for Students

Source
Institutional Communication Center - Deanship of Student Affairs

The College of Law Club organized a mock trial on human trafficking on Sunday, October 5, 2025, at the college auditorium, aiming to provide students with practical training in criminal procedures from arrest to final judgment. The trial included four main stages: investigation and arrest, where students demonstrated how initial procedures are conducted; interrogation, during which defendants were questioned and witnesses summoned in a realistic courtroom setting; trial proceedings, in which the public prosecutor presented the case and requested the appropriate penalty; and finally, pronouncement of judgment, where the verdict was logically reasoned and detailed, reflecting the students’ understanding of legal processes and the importance of justice.
